I-75 Mile Marker 93, Southbound in a "Construction Zone"
Township of Clinton in Shelby County, mile marker 93, Southbound. Trooper stands by his car and points at your car when he wants to stop you. There may be many cars going the same speed but he will stop one at random. It can be after 5:00 PM — he was there at 6:30 PM on a Thursday evening with NO CONSTRUCTION PERSONNEL, and it was NOT an ACTIVE Construction Zone. His excuse is that there might be construction going on at night. There was none. He is on the Right Hand Side of the road, and monitors the Left lane (the lanes split, and if you take the “fast” or left lane you are in his cross-hairs). He is not right where the speed changes, he is down the road a bit. Ticket says the officer is using LADAR. He is not even a State Trooper, he is a local cop printing money for the municipality.
